There … WebEach haiku poem is given a structure known as 5-7-5, and the whole poem consists of only three lines, with 17 syllables in total. The first line is 5 syllables. The second line is 7 syllables. The third line is 5 syllables. While traditional Japanese haiku poems were printed as one single line, they often appear across three lines when ... For example, a perfect rhyme is when the words sound alike. When discussing rhyming schemes in poems, poets use letters, such as a, b, c, to refer to the rhymes. Meter: a meter is the rhythmic element of words or lines in a poem. A meter comprises syllables that are stressed or unstressed.
